Transaction abb2d08857e086b692c865fd645530a17559054599dbcbec0f488d3e6c6956fe
1 Input
1 Outputs
- abb2d08857e086b692c865fd645530a17559054599dbcbec0f488d3e6c6956fe:0
value 423649
address 18Yvj49T5c1fjgJUQBkBCbEfZsDSozY4X5